When a country 'burns out', was infected but either the lethality level or other incidents kill off most of the infected, thus becoming 'safe' again, I think that if there are transmission forms unrelated to direct person-person contact (Birds, rats, insects, animals, necrosis to name a few) that there should be a small 're-occurrence' rate as the pathogen is still viable and exists on carriers within their borders.
